After a good long listen to the first few weeks of Disrupt, I’ll definitely say that SEN have hit a niche and deserve to be congratulated.

The breakfast show borders on filling the gap between the ABC and Nine, with a smattering of modern music, and decent, somewhat thought provoking, yet reasonable topics.

Whilst throughout the day it’s somewhat business heavy, it seems to be more of a “Progressive Gen-X/Y talk” oriented station, and one that should definitely be considered as a format for AM/FM.

Sadly, they only seem to have programming Mon-Fri 7a-6p, with repeats ad nauseum the rest of the time.
This, and the fact that some of the shows feel more like podcasts than actual content, does let it down.

Either way, hats off to SEN, it’s definitely worth a listen, if that’s your thing.
